Why do you even put numbers on your car? I've never been to a track day yet where the organizers required them. Some groups require that? Or is it to look cool on the street?

Our group requires numbers. It's to assist the corner works and crew. When you've got 10 miatas that are black or sliver at an event, they need to be able to tell them apart.
